Celtic’s latest title triumph owes much to Brendan Rodgers’ frustrated ambitions | Ewan Murray

Scotland’s most powerful force needn’t be wildly praised for topping the pile yet again but the manager deserves respectTwelve months from now, Brendan Rodgers will either be preparing to bid farewell to Celtic for surely the final time or the manager will be embarking on phase two of this second tenure. Mystery around the more likely scenario means that what happens next to Celtic is far more intriguing than the comfortable retention of their Scottish title. Make that 13 in 14 years.Rodgers will already know his future plan. So, too, will Dermot Desmond. There may be no official board role for Celtic’s principal shareholder and no public utterances on all things Celtic, but Rodgers has been sure to drop in that he deals directly with the Irish billionaire as opposed to, say, the club’s chair, Peter Lawwell. If this feels structurally odd, it is the kind of thing that is ignored while the team keeps winning. Continue reading...
